Portfolio Manager

I had to make a portfolio for my school's assessment. Now I could make a plain ol' paper one, but since my specialization study will be Creative Technology, I figured I couldn't do this.

Instead I decided something more... sophisticated. Thus my Flash XML Content Management System was born. Let's call it FXC, shall we?

My goal with this project was to make an application which can be fully customized using XML. You can specify data, and the application displays it in a visually appealing way.

Now the technical side of the application is finished. Well, finished enough for my assessment Monday, but I wanna add an extra level of customization before releasing it.

When it's done for my assessment, I'll show it to you of course. I consider this my most advanced CMS yet, it probably is. I'm loving it :D

Current features:

  • You can specify different XML content sheets, for instance, for allowing quality settings, different galleries, etc.

  • You can make categories, which are selectable in a main screen.

  • Each category is configurable with imagery and sound

  • Inside a category, you can have links. The links are represented by bug-like movieclips, which you can also specify yourself

  • Each category has the following configurable items:

    • A background image and for animation, a blurred version of the backgroun

    • A colorset

    • Music

    • The animated movieclip

    • The links to content, with status text and hoverbox text

    • Probably much more in the released-to-public version

My FTIR/ReacTable journey begins!

Today I finished my 1st test setup. It was pretty basic (about as basic as you can get), involving a glass plate, a garbage bin bag, a modded webcam and a fiducial created with ducktape and plastic. And it worked. It worked!

Tomorrow I will try it out with a beamer. Sgonna be fun to build up, since I got no materials at school :P
